THE MISSION OF JACKSON-FEILD BEHAVIORAL HEALTH SERVICES IS TO PROVIDE HIGH QUALITY, EVIDENCE-BASED PSYCHIATRIC, RESIDENTIAL, EDUCATIONAL, AND RECOVERY TREATMENT SERVICES FOR CHILDREN WHO SUFFER FROM SEVERE EMOTIONAL TRAUMA, MENTAL ILLNESS AND/OR SUBSTANCE USE ADDICTION. OUR GOAL IS TO RESTORE WELLNESS AND PROVIDE SUPPORT FOR SUCCESSFUL REINTEGRATION INTO HOMES, FAMILIES, AND COMMUNITIES.
